Understanding Night Terrors: A Medical Perspective

If you’re experiencing night terrors, it’s important to understand them from a medical perspective.

Night terrors are intense episodes of fear or dread that occur during sleep. They can be quite distressing and may leave you feeling scared and confused.

While the exact cause of night terrors is not completely understood, there are several medical causes that have been identified. These include sleep disorders such as insomnia, anxiety disorders, and certain medications.

It’s essential to consult with a healthcare professional to determine the underlying cause of your night terrors and explore possible treatment options. Treatment may involve addressing any underlying medical conditions, implementing healthy sleep habits, and in some cases, medication or therapy.

Remember, seeking medical guidance is crucial in understanding and managing night terrors effectively.

Cultural and Folklore Interpretations of Night Terrors

Cultural and folklore interpretations shed light on the significance of night terrors in different societies.

In many cultures, night terrors are believed to be caused by spiritual entities or supernatural forces. For example, in some Native American tribes, it is believed that night terrors occur when a person’s soul leaves their body and encounters malevolent spirits. These spirits can cause fear and terror during sleep.

Similarly, in African folklore, night terrors are often attributed to evil spirits or witches who visit people while they sleep. These cultural interpretations highlight the belief that night terrors have a deeper spiritual meaning beyond just being a normal sleep disorder.

Understanding these cultural interpretations can provide insight into how different societies perceive and interpret the phenomenon of night terrors, giving us a broader perspective on this mysterious condition.
